đż What Is Slow Gardening?
Slow gardening is not about growing faster or bigger.
Itâs about:
- Being present
- Enjoying the process
- Letting plants grow at their own pace
No pressure. No rush. Just rhythm.

đż How to Start Slow Gardening at Home
You donât need a big garden. Start simple:
- Care for one or two plants
- Water slowly, not automatically
- Observe changes instead of rushing growth
- Create a small âpause cornerâ with greenery
Even a single plant can become part of your daily rhythm.
